Technology. Some days it feels like we can’t live with it, but in today’s world we certainly can’t live without it. And what’s the mental health impact on our kids and teens who seem consumed by their smartphones and other digital media 24/7?
The short answer is: It’s a gray area. There are both pros and cons to technology. If we understand the causes for concerns and the benefits, alike, we can make the most of the media in our lives.
In this video, Gene Beresin and Steve Schlozman, co-hosts of our podcast “Shrinking It Down: Mental Health Made Simple,” make sense of living with technology and what it means for the young people in your life.
